Dr Koenigsberg
I am not sure of the purpose of the quotes listed here ref immunity, but
they unashamedly assume that all 'foreign invasion' with reference to
sovereign nations is necessarily harmful.  Indeed, the very terminology
'foreign invasion' is itself a highly emotive manner in which to describe
anything from, for example, one North Korean asylum seeker to 25 Indian bus
workers in the mid 20th C UK etc, etc.
Moreover, the analogy does not hold, even if one were able to argue
coherently that all (personal) bodily foreign invasions were necessarily not
a good thing.  Do you mean to suggest that the apparatus of the body politic
involved in 'defending' against any kind of 'foreign invasion' helps to make
the sovereign state stronger insofar as it can learn how to deal with the
next, similar invasion in the same way?  This is a very shaky standpoint if
it is the one you imply here and i do not believe you would be so
disingenious, please enlighten as to the purpose of the posting to which I
have replied.

Weiner, M. A. in MAXIMUM IMMUNITY.

      "Your immune system is programmed to take care of the day-to-day job
of protecting you against foreign invaders. Imagine that you body is a
sovereign nation--a complete, separate organism.  What prevents your body,
the host country, from becoming a Petri dish for every kind of bacterium
&virus?  That is the job of your immune system.  It is the immune system
that protects you from attack by foreign &internal agents, that plans
defensive actions, and that provides the necessary personnel &equipment."


Lennart Nilsson in THE BODY VICTORIOUS:

      "The organization of the human immune system is reminiscent of
military defense, with regard to both weapon technology and strategy. Our
internal army has at its disposal swift, highly mobile regiments, shock
troops, snipers, and tanks. We have soldier cells which, on contact with the
enemy, at once start producing homing missiles whose accuracy is
overwhelming. Our defense system also boasts ammunition which pierces and
bursts bacteria."

Melanie Klein (interpreted by Ogden):

      "Biological processes are mirrored in activities of the mind called
unconscious phantasies.  Phantasy is the psychic representation of one's
biology.  Mental phenomena have physiologic substrates."

Lacan:

      "The unconscious is structured like a language."

Koenigsberg:

      "Language is structured like the unconscious."
